Preventive Maintenance Strategy: Protecting the Full Monitoring Loop

A proximity probe failure rarely occurs in isolation. When the 24701-28-05-00-075-04-02 is flagged for replacement during a scheduled shutdown or emergency inspection, experienced maintenance engineers know that the entire measurement chain deserves scrutiny. The probe is only one element of the 3300 XL Eddy Current System — its performance depends on the integrity of every upstream and downstream component.

Begin with the extension cable (typically the 330130-045-00-CN or equivalent 3300 XL series cable). Extension cables are subject to mechanical fatigue, connector corrosion, and insulation degradation, especially in high-vibration or high-temperature zones. A probe replacement paired with a worn extension cable will not restore measurement accuracy. Inspect the cable jacket, connector pins, and coaxial shielding before reinstalling.

Next, verify the condition of the Proximitor® driver/oscillator — such as the 330180-X1-05 or 3300 XL 8mm Proximitor Sensor. The driver converts the probe’s impedance change into a usable DC voltage signal. A drifting or failed driver will produce erroneous readings even with a new probe installed. During any probe swap, bench-test the driver output against a known-good target at a calibrated gap to confirm linearity.

At the rack level, inspect the 3300 XL monitor module (e.g., 3300/20-02-01-00 Dual Vibration Monitor) for alarm setpoint integrity, OK relay status, and buffered output signal quality. These modules are often overlooked during field replacements but are a common source of false OK signals after a probe failure event. If the monitor has been in service for more than five years without calibration verification, schedule a bench check during the same maintenance window.

For plants running Bently Nevada 3500 Series machinery protection systems alongside legacy 3300 XL installations, confirm that the 3500/42M or 3500/40M proximity monitor cards are correctly configured for the probe sensitivity and gap voltage. Mixed-series installations are a frequent source of configuration drift after personnel changes or system upgrades.

Do not overlook the terminal board and I/O wiring within the monitoring rack. Loose terminal connections, oxidized contacts, and incorrect shielding grounding are responsible for a significant proportion of intermittent vibration alarms. While the probe is out of service, use the opportunity to torque-check all terminal screws on the associated 3500 I/O module or 3300 XL junction box.

Finally, if the plant operates a System 1® condition monitoring software platform, update the probe configuration record after replacement. Confirm that the new probe’s serial number, calibration date, and gap voltage are logged in the asset database. This step is critical for audit compliance and for establishing a reliable maintenance history that supports future predictive maintenance decisions.

A comprehensive inspection during a single planned shutdown — covering the probe, extension cable, Proximitor driver, monitor module, terminal wiring, and software configuration — is far less costly than a second unplanned outage caused by a component that was overlooked during the first repair.

Q3: How should I verify probe compatibility before installation in an existing 3300 XL system?
Confirm the probe diameter (8mm), cable length (5m), and output sensitivity (7.87 V/mm) match your existing system configuration. Check the Proximitor driver model number against the Bently Nevada compatibility matrix. Measure the installed gap voltage at the driver output with the probe positioned at the nominal gap — it should read approximately -10.5 VDC for a steel target at 1.0 mm gap. Any significant deviation indicates a driver or wiring issue, not a probe defect.
